Validate XML Using XSD

You can validate XML documents against any data model defined using W3C XSD, using any major XSD Validator, including MSXML 3.0, MSXML 4.0, MSXML 6.0, Xerces-J, Xerces-C, Microsoft System.XML (1.0 and 2.0), XSV, the Saxonica XSD Validator and others.
